Default water changes

how does everbody do them?When i pump new water back to my tank,i always have to pump sme of it out because of the sulfide that form from previous change.Any ideas its a waste of new water.I just cant completely empty the hose out since it is 20 feet long.

I use about 35 feet of hose to pump the water from my mixing tank to the sump for water changes. I just disconnect at the pump, then coil up the hose draining the residual water into the sump as I go.
